Summary

Petrobras reported a substantial increase in 2025 net income, unveiled a $109 billion strategic plan for 2026-2030, and reversed prior divestment plans for key refining and gas assets, while also detailing new tax implications for dividends.


Key Events · Corporate Governance and Compliance · PBR

  • Strong 2025 Financial Performance

    Net income attributable to shareholders surged 160.8% to US$19,634 million, though Free Cash Flow decreased by 29.1% to US$16,528 million.

  • Ambitious 2026-2030 Strategic Plan

    Unveiled a US$109 billion CAPEX plan, with 72% allocated to Exploration & Production and 12% to low-carbon energy initiatives, targeting peak oil production of 2.7 million bpd by 2028.

  • Reversal of Key Divestment Plans

    Amended agreements with CADE eliminate obligations to sell five refineries (RNEST, REPAR, REFAP, REGAP, LUBNOR) and the gas transportation company TBG, indicating a strategic shift to retain core assets.

  • New Tax on Dividends

    Brazilian Law No. 15,270/2025 introduces a 10% withholding income tax on profits and dividends exceeding R$50,000 per month, effective January 2026.


Analysis · PBR · Energy & Transportation

This annual report provides a comprehensive overview of Petrobras's strong financial performance in 2025, driven by a significant increase in net income. The company has outlined an ambitious $109 billion strategic plan for 2026-2030, heavily focused on exploration and production, as well as a notable expansion into low-carbon energy and biofuels. Critically, the report details the reversal of previous divestment commitments for several refineries and gas transportation assets (TBG) following agreements with CADE, signaling a strategic shift towards retaining and investing in these core assets. New tax regulations, including a 10% withholding tax on profits and dividends from 2026, will impact future shareholder returns. The resolution of the EIG lawsuit with a $283 million settlement removes a significant legal overhang. Investors should note the increased debt and leverage, alongside the strategic pivot in asset ownership and the long-term capital allocation towards both traditional oil & gas and energy transition initiatives.
